Wood siding replacement services involve removing existing damaged or deteriorating wood siding and installing new materials to restore the exterior appearance and integrity of a property. This process typically includes carefully removing the old siding, preparing the underlying structure, and then installing new wood panels or planks that match the original design or desired aesthetic. Skilled contractors ensure proper sealing and fastening to enhance durability and prevent issues such as warping, cracking, or moisture intrusion, which can compromise the building’s exterior over time.
One of the primary issues addressed by wood siding replacement is the presence of damage caused by rot, pests, weather exposure, or age. Over time, wood siding can develop cracks, holes, or warping that not only diminish the visual appeal but also allow moisture to penetrate the underlying structure. Replacing compromised siding hel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of mold growth, and maintains the property's structural integrity.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ood siding replacement typ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ected. Higher-end options like cedar or redwood can incre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on the specific materials chosen.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. These rates can vary based on the complexity of the project and local market conditions.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to the project scope.
Total Project Costs - Overall costs for wood siding replacement usually range from $5 to $13 per square foot, including materials and labor. Larger or more intricate projects may exceed this range, depending on specific requirements and site conditions.
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as removal of old siding, surface preparation, or repairs may add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s can vary based on the condition of existing siding and site accessibility. Local contractors can offer precise estimates after assessment.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What signs indicate that wood siding needs to be replaced? Visible damage such as rotting, warping, cracking, or insect infestation are common indicators that replacement may be necessary. A professional assessment can confirm the condition of the siding.
Are there different types of wood siding available for replacement? Yes, options include cedar, pine, redwood, and other wood varieties, each with different appearances and durability. Local siding specialists can advise on suitable choices for your home.
Can w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ages can sometimes be repaired, but extensive rot or deterioration often require full replacement. Consulting with a local siding expert can help determine the best approach.
What maintenance is required after wood siding replacement? Regular inspections, cleaning, and repainting or sealing can help prolong the lifespan of wood siding. Local service providers can offer maintenance recommendations.
